Profile Summary
Uscom Limited is an Australia-based medical technology company that specializes in the development and marketing of non-invasive cardiovascular and pulmonary medical devices. The Company sells two cardiovascular products, the USCOM 1A cardiac output monitor and the Uscom BP+ central blood pressure monitor and a series of pulmonary products, the Uscom SpiroSonic spirometers. The USCOM 1A is a non-invasive advanced hemodynamic monitor that measures cardiovascular function using Doppler ultrasound to detect abnormalities and guide treatment. The BP+ is a supra-systolic oscillometric central blood pressure monitor, which measures blood pressure and blood pressure waveforms at the heart, as well as in the arm. Uscom SpiroSonic digital ultrasonic spirometers are digital, pulmonary function testing devices based on multi-path ultrasound technology. It has geographic sales and distribution segments, which include Australia, Asia, the Americas and Europe.

The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
